Colombo Marasala Recipe Contest Chef Finalists Announced!
We partnered with Colombo Marsala Wine to create a unique recipe contest where chefs can win a trip to Italy to visit the Toscana Saporita Cooking school. The results are in, and these are the five chef finalists! Their recipes will be cooked and blind-tested by a panel of chefs and a winner announced soon. Wish them luck!

Here are our five finalists (in no particular order):
Kyle Itani of Hopscotch in Oakland
Japanese pickled sardines Nanbanzuke style
Amy Sayles of Panzano in Denver
"Cheese & Wine" Paremsan panna cotta, Marsala cinnamon gallett cracker and white sugar apple "chips"
Giorgio Rapicavoli of Eating House and Taperia Raca in Miami
Veal Marsala ‘tartare’ with shallots, raw mushroom and fried rosemary
Jenn Louis of Lincoln and Sunshine Tavern in Portland
Foie gras parfait and pork-Marsala terrine with Marsala sultanas
Mary Catherine Curren of Easy Tiger Bake Shop & Beer Garden, Arro and 24 Diner in Austin
Colombo Marsala poached pear and almond tart with CoCoa Nibs and Gorgonzola Dolce cream
